Second Hand Daniel Stott, Royal Naval Reserve. He served aboard H.M.S. “Victory” and H. M. Drifter ” Sunbeam ” and died on Service in Haslar Royal Naval Hospital from pneumonia on 11th September 1918, aged 22. He had been born in Eyemouth and was the son of James Stott, fisherman of Mason’s Wynd, Eyemouth. He had enlisted in April 1915 and served for three years before transferring to ” Victory” the shore base at Portsmouth. He was a keen member of St Ebba’s Masonic Lodge and was buried with full masonic honours in Eyemouth Kirkyard.
